Wanshih Electronic Co Ltd (6134) — Net Asset Quality Index

Latest as of September 2025: 51.0%

Wanshih Electronic Co Ltd (6134)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 51.0% as of September 2025.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of NT$2.04 Billion minus total liabilities of NT$997.63 Million yields net assets of NT$1.04 Billion. A higher index indicates a stronger, lower-leverage balance sheet. Check Wanshih Electronic Co Ltd liquidity resilience to evaluate the company's liquid asset resilience ratio.

Annual Net Asset Quality Index for Wanshih Electronic Co Ltd (2017–2024)

The table below presents the year-by-year Net Asset Quality Index for Wanshih Electronic Co Ltd from 2017 to 2024, covering 8 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, total liabilities, net assets, the quality index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year Quality Index Net Assets (TWD) Total Assets Total Liabilities Change (pp)
2024 61.7% NT$1.11 Billion NT$1.80 Billion NT$688.43 Million ▲ +1.7 pp
2023 60.0% NT$887.46 Million NT$1.48 Billion NT$590.60 Million ▲ +10.0 pp
2022 50.0% NT$861.16 Million NT$1.72 Billion NT$860.36 Million ▼ -7.2 pp
2021 57.2% NT$997.04 Million NT$1.74 Billion NT$746.29 Million ▲ +8.8 pp
2020 48.4% NT$870.87 Million NT$1.80 Billion NT$927.40 Million ▼ -51.5 pp
2019 99.9% NT$1.51 Billion NT$1.51 Billion NT$1.66 Million ▲ +47.7 pp
2018 52.2% NT$864.91 Million NT$1.66 Billion NT$792.30 Million ▲ +1.8 pp
2017 50.4% NT$882.47 Million NT$1.75 Billion NT$868.25 Million
pp = percentage points
